Barcelona Sets Its Sights on Pablo Barrios
Wednesday 15-10-2025
The website "Fichajes" revealed that FC Barcelona has begun to track the young player Pablo Barrios, a midfielder for Atletico Madrid, as a promising option to strengthen the team's midfield in the near future. Although there is no official confirmation, the player's name appears on the list of candidates to reinforce Barcelona's midfield.

Barrios is considered one of the key players at Atletico Madrid under Diego Simeone, having recently renewed his contract until 2030, reflecting the club's great confidence in him. The player has also surpassed 100 official matches with the first team and won a gold medal with the Spanish national team at the Paris 2024 Olympics, making his debut with the senior national team, which enhances his status on the international level.

Barrios represents a suitable option for Barcelona due to his ability to regain possession and advance the ball, along with his precise shooting and exceptional vision of the field.

As Robert Lewandowski's contract nears its end, Barcelona is looking to strengthen its midfield and connect it with the attack. Barrios is considered a player capable of contributing in this area through his runs from the second line and high pressing on opponents.

However, Atletico Madrid will not make it easy for one of its standout talents to leave, given Barrios's recent renewal and the high release clause in his contract. It is expected that discussions about signing him will take place during the upcoming summer transfer window, with consideration for compensating Atletico Madrid appropriately.

Barcelona continues to monitor Barrios, who has become one of the standout young talents in La Liga, as a future option to enhance the team's midfield with leadership and youthful abilities.
